| Nickname: | Orson Welles / G.O. Spelvin / O.W. Jeeves / |
| Known for: | Citizen Kane, Touch of Evil, The Magnificent Ambersons |
| Birth name: | George Orson Welles |
| Birthday: | 6 May 1915, Kenosha, Wisconsin, USA |
| Height: | 6' 1½" (1.87 m) |

Welles' 'kane' Remains Citizen No. 1 Among Afi's Greatest Movies
LOS ANGELES (AP) - The years have been kind to ''Citizen Kane,'' including the last decade. The 1941 Orson Welles classic - the story of a wealthy young idealist transformed by scandal and vice into a regretful old recluse - was again rated the best movie ever Wednesday by the American Film Institute.
